Suns play at the Lakers on Monday before returning home to play the Warriors on Wednesday.

Lakers (39-12) beat the Warriors on Saturday 125-120.

Suns (21-32) are hoping to bounce back after their loss to the Nuggets but this will be a tough game to do it.

The game will be televised on FSAZ.

Start time is 8:30 p.m. MST (Arizona time).
